Bentley Magnetic motors Limited (/ˈbɛntli/) is a British company that styles, develops, and manufactures luxury motorcars that are largely hand-built. It is a additional of Volkswagen AG. Now based in Crewe, England, Bentley Motors Limited has been founded by W. O. Bentley on 18 January 1919 in Cricklewood, North London.Bentley cars are marketed via franchised dealers world-wide, and as of Late 2012, China was the greatest market.Most Bentley cars are assembled in the Crewe factory, but a small number of Continental Flying Spurs are assembled at the factory in Dresden, Germany. Bodies for the Continental are manufactured in Zwickau, Germany.Bentley won the 1 day of Le Mans throughout 1924, 1927, 1928, 1929, 1930, and 2003.

Iconic Bentley models add some Bentley 4½ Litre, Bentley Speed Six, Bentley R Type Continental, Bentley Turbo R, and Bentley Arnage. As of 2015, Bentley produce the Continental Flying Spur, Continental GT, Bentley Bentayga and the particular Mulsanne.Rolls-Royce bought Bentley from the receivers in 1931 in addition to subsequently sold it for you to Vickers plc in 1980 as soon as Rolls-Royce themselves went insolvent. In 1998, Vickers sold it to be able to Volkswagen AG. The sale included the auto designs, model nameplates, production and administrative amenities, the Spirit of Inspiration and Rolls-Royce grille appearance trademarks, but not the rights for the Rolls-Royce name or logo that are owned by Rolls-Royce Holdings plc as well as were licensed to BMW AG.Before World War My spouse and i, Walter Owen Bentley, and his brother, Horace Millner Bentley, sold French DFP autos in Cricklewood, North London, but W. O, as Walter was recognized, always wanted to design and build his own cars. At the DFP manufacturing facility, in 1913, he noticed an lightweight aluminum paperweight and thought that aluminum may be a suitable replacement intended for cast iron to fabricate brighter pistons. The first Bentley aluminum pistons were suited to Sopwith Camel aero engines during World War My spouse and i.In August 1919, W. O. registered Bentley Motors Ltd. and in October he exhibited an auto chassis, with dummy engine, at the London Engine Show. Ex-Royal Flying Corps officer, Clive Gallop, designed an innovative 4 valves per cylinder engine for the chassis. By December the serp was built and running. Delivery of the initial cars was scheduled intended for June 1920, but development took longer than estimated so the date was extended to September 1921. The durability of the initial Bentley cars earned widespread acclaim and so they competed in hill climbs and raced at Brooklands.Bentley's first major affair was the 1922 Indianapolis 500, a race, dominated by specialized vehicles with Duesenberg racing chassis. They entered a revised road car driven by works driver, Douglas Hawkes, accompanied by riding technician, H. S. "Bertie" Browning. Hawkes completed the full 500 miles and finished 13th through an average speed of 74. 95 mph after starting off in 19th position. The team was then rushed to England to compete inside 1922 RAC Tourist Trophy.Captain Woolf BarnatoIn ironic reference to his heavyweight boxer's stature, Captain Woolf Barnato has been nicknamed "Babe". In 1925, he acquired his initial Bentley, a 3-litre. With this car this individual won numerous Brooklands backrounds. Just a year in the future he acquired the Bentley enterprise itself.The Bentley enterprise has been always underfunded, but inspired by this 1924 Le Mans acquire by John Duff along with Frank Clement, Barnato agreed to financial Bentley's business. Barnato had incorporated Baromans Ltd in 1922, which existed as his / her finance and investment auto. Via Baromans, Barnato initially invested more than £100, 000, saving the business and it is workforce. A financial reorganisation of the original Bentley company was executed and all existing creditors paid off for £75, 000. Existing shares were devalued through £1 each to simply 1 shilling, or 5% or the original value. Barnato held 149, 500 of the brand new shares giving him control on the company and he evolved into chairman. Barnato injected further cash in the business: £35, 000 secured by debenture with July 1927; £40, 000 in 1928; £25, 000 in 1929. With renewed financial insight, W. O. Bentley was able to style another generation of automobiles.

The particular Bentley Boys were several British motoring enthusiasts in which included Woolf Barnato, Sir Henry "Tim" Birkin, steeple chaser George Duller, aviator Glen Kidston, automotive journalist S. C. H. "Sammy" Davis, and Dr Dudley Benjafield. The Bentley Boys, favored Bentley cars. Many were independently wealthy and quite often had a military track record. They kept the marque's reputation for high end alive; Bentley was noted to its four consecutive victories in the 24 Hours of The Mans from 1927 in order to 1930.In 1929, Tim Birkin developed this 4½ litre, lightweight Blower Bentley in Welwyn Garden City and produced five racing deals, starting with Bentley Motorized inflator No. 1 which was optimised with the Brooklands racing circuit. Birkin overruled W. O. and put the model on the market before it was completely developed. As a result, it was unreliable.

In March 1930, during the Blue Teach Races, Woolf Barnato raised this stakes on Rover and it is Rover Light Six, having raced and survived Le Train Bleu for the very first time, to better that record in reference to his 6½-litre Bentley Speed Six over a bet of £100. He drove against the particular train from Cannes to be able to Calais, then by ferry for you to Dover, and finally London, travelling on public roads, and won.

Barnato went his H. J. Mulliner-bodied formal saloon inside the race against the Violet Train. Two months later, on 21 May 1930, he took delivery of the Speed Six with sleek fastback "Sportsman Coupé" by simply Gurney Nutting. Both cars became often known as the "Blue Train Bentleys"; the latter is often mistaken for, or erroneously referred to as being, the car that raced the Blue Train, while in fact Barnato named it in memory regarding his race. [19][20] A painting by means of Terence Cuneo depicts the Gurney Nutting coupé race along a road parallel towards the Blue Train, which scenario never occurred since the road and railway did not follow the same option.
